An inflexible attitude about a particular group of people rooted in generalizations and stereotypes. Often unchangeable "All Irish are drunks", "All Mexicans are lazy"

Answer:

Prejudice

Step-by-step explanation:

Prejudice is a way of thinking about a certain group of people based on the stereotypes about them. The groups can range from racial groups, gender-based, and even political affiliations. Prejudiced thinking is commonly negative and is usually not based on rational thoughts. It is often used as a way to create in-group/out-group distinction and has often been used to justify many atrocities in the world.
